The first impression
Gold No. 10 by Puredistance is a Oriental Spicy fragrance for women and men. Gold No. 10 was launched in 2019. The nose behind this fragrance is Antoine Lie. Top notes are Calabrian bergamot, Green Mandarin, Pink Pepper, Rosemary and Clove; middle notes are Spanish Labdanum, Cinnamon, Indian Jasmine and Geranium; base notes are Benzoin, Styrax, Myrhh, Tonka Bean, Madagascar Vanilla, Castoreum, Patchouli and Vetiver.

The perfumer behind it
Antoine Lie
Antoine Lie is a French perfumer trained at Givaudan and known for his work with brands like Burberry and Avon. His style often blends bold contrasts, pairing fresh or woody accords with unexpected gourmand or metallic touches. He created the earthy, resinous Sequoia for Abbott New York City and the spicy, incense-laced Sword for CZAR, showcasing his skill with complex, atmospheric compositions.
